Nissan and Honda to co-develop SDVs, EV platforms, batteries and e-axles
Nissan Motor and Honda Motor have announced that they have agreed to carry out joint research in fundamental technologies in the area of platforms for next-generation software-defined vehicles (SDVs). Automotive Suspension Coil Springs Market size is set to grow by USD 696.7 million from 2024-2028, Increase in production of passenger and commercial vehicles to boost the market growth, Technavio
NEW YORK, Aug. 2,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— The global automotive suspension coil springs market size is estimated to grow by USD 696.7 million from 2024-2028, according to Technavio. The market is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 4.5% during the forecast period. Hyundai Venue S(O) + launched at Rs 10 lakh
Hyundai has introduced a new S(O) + variant for the Venue at Rs 10 lakh. The new variant essentially adds an electric sunroof over the S(O) variant it is based on, making it the most affordable variant to be offered with this feature.
